Pagini recente » Cod sursa (job #2276986) | Cod sursa (job #1842616) | Cod sursa (job #254237) | Cod sursa (job #2350410) | Cod sursa (job #1292594)
# include <bits/stdc++.h>
using namespace std;
ifstream fi("koba.in");
ofstream fo("koba.out");
int s[int(1e8 + 5)];
int main(void)
{
int n,m=0;
fi >> n >> s[1] >> s[2] >> s[3];
s[1]%=10;s[2]%=10;s[3]%=10;
for (m=4;m<=n;++m)
{
s[m] = (s[m-1] + s[m-2] * s[m-3]) % 10;
if (s[m] == s[3] && s[m-1] == s[2] && s[m-2] == s[1]) break;
}
if (m < n) m-=3;
int p = n / m;
int ans=0;
for (int i=1;i<=m;++i) ans+=s[i];
ans*=p;p=n%m;
for (int i=1;i<=p;++i) ans+=s[i];
return fo << ans << '\n',0;
}